Do You Gain Weight Back After Stopping Ozempic?

Diabetes Lawsuit | Medical Drugs
It is common for you to gain weight back after stopping Ozempic®. In one study, people regained up to two-thirds of the weight they lost after they stopped taking semaglutide, the active ingredient in Ozempic during the first year.
